ALKALINE: A DEFINITION

The alkalinity of an alkaline water filter’s output can be indicated with a pH meter.

A pH meter provides a value as to how acidic or alkaline a liquid is.
The pH meter measures concentration of hydrogen ions in water.
Acids dissolved in water forming positively charged hydrogen ions (H+).

The greater this concentration of hydrogen ions, the more acidic the liquid may be.

Water Alkalinity or Acidity

Water is neutral at a reading of pH 7.
A lesser reading means the water is acid.
pH 6 is 10x more acidic than pH 7 and pH 5 is 100x more acidic than pH7.
A higher reading indicates alkalinity.

Introducing.. the alkaline water ionizer, AKA water alkalizer, AKA alkaline water filter.

This is the device one aggrieved author is upset about. He is a chemist. Here’s an excerpt:

As water molecules break down at the negative electrode to release hydrogen gas, they leave behind negative hydroxide ions. This is what makes a solution “alkaline.” Basically what this means is that as electrolysis proceeds, a dilute solution of sodium hydroxide (negative ions are always paired with positive ones) is produced around the negative electrode and can be drawn off as “alkaline” or “ionized” water. But you don't need an exorbitantly expensive device to produce a dilute sodium hydroxide solution. A couple of pellets of drain cleaner in a litre of water will do the job. So will a spoonful of baking soda. Of course these solutions will not produce any medical miracles. But neither will the posh alkaline water.

A water ionizer filters your tap water, then passes electricity through water, separating it into acid and alkaline streams.

Users drink the alkaline water, and the acid water (usually) goes down the drain.
Input and filter a litre of water from your tap, and you’ll get about half of the water out the other end with the original alkaline minerals in it.

pH Test for alkaline water filter

Testing an Alkaline Water Filter for Alkalinity


A pH reagent test - can easily be deceived, and the easiest way to do this is to use exactly what the alkaline water ionizer uses: electrolysis.

Electrolysis affects the reading of a pH meter because it is reading the result of electrolysis instead of pure alkaline minerals in the water. It produces a dilute solution of sodium hydroxide - enough to quite radically affect a pH reading to make it look more alkaline than it really is.

So the person in a low alkaline water supply region is told to hit a button to boost the electricity that passes through their input water in their shiny new water ionizer, and lo and behold!

The pH meter or reagent shows a ‘healthy’ pH in the desired range of 8.5 to 9.5.

On the other hand, when a water supply is (as it is in vast areas of America, Australia and Europe!) already alkaline, the ionizer delivers the alkaline minerals already in the water, ‘repackaging them’ as ‘new and improved’ ionized water. If the water ionizer was set at the high voltage of the soft water area, then the readings on the pH meter would also be (falsely) high. (and the water may cause vomiting or diarrhea).

Buffered Alkaline Water Filter vs. Unbuffered Alkaline Water filter.

Except.. the soaring pH does NOT reflect the true alkalinity of the water. It reflects the combined alkalinity of the water and the result of electrolysis. It is technically known as unbuffered alkaline water.

Unbuffered alkaline water is water that has little to no alkalinizing power.

If you have an electric water ionizer it's a simple test.
Add just a drop of acidic Vitamin C for instance, and it loses all its ‘alkalinity’.

Unbuffered alkaline water will virtually immediately be neutralised by acids in the mouth or stomach. Net result; zero.

Buffered water contains actual dissolved alkaline minerals. It is not artificially boosted in pH by electrolysis. These minerals, once ingested, join our own alkaline storehouse and suppl3ement, or top up our ‘bank’ of alkalinity with the ability to neutralise acids.

Try the acid drop test on a glass of buffered natural alkaline water: you’ll need a lot more acid to bring the alkaline water up to neutral pH7.
